Contents Preface 1 Regional dimensions of agricultural development and povertySurendra Singh 2 Regional planning for sustainable agriculture development--a case study of AssamPC Dutta N Roy and B Choudhury 3 Disparities in agricultural development in Madhya Pradesh a study of rates pattern and production relationsShri Prakash 4 Inter-state disparities and policy measuresB Satyanarayan 5 Regional balance and resource transfer from centre to statesKamta Prasad 6 Growth and structure of exports of industrial goods from PunjabInderpal Kaur 7 The need for transforming natural resources for sustainable and balanced developmentSK Sharma 8 Human development in India an inter-state comparisonNaseem A Zaidi and Md Abdus Salam 9 Fallacies and constraints of balanced regional development in IndiaML Patel 10 An alternative approach into the process of regional developmentPG Marvania 11 Policy measures for balanced and sustainable agricultural developmentKanchan Marvania 12 Decentralised planning issues and training implications an analytical frameworkAmitava Mukherjee and BN Yugandhar 13 Decentralised planning concept approach implication and lacunasAmitabh Shukla and Rahul Singh 14 Democratic decentralisation through Panchayati Raj administration a study of its prospects in MizoramRN Prasad IndexDevelopment is a complex notion and it has multi-fold dimensions specially with regard to process of planning It has several linkages and casual relationship with natural geographical social economic and political aspectsIts a long debate in the theories of planning that whether centralised planning system or decentralised planning system is good for solving the problems of a nationThe answer lies in the fact which is evident by empirical evidences and experiences that a scientific planning system should be based upon a scientific approach ie Regional planning which is a combination of several natural geographical economic social factors etc The present book is an attempt in this directionThis book provides a deep insight and empirical evidences on the relation of various aspects of regional planning with development through which the planning mechanism can be strengthened It analyses the dimensions of natural endowments infrastructural agricultural industrial and human development as well as evaluates the role of resource transfers decentralisation federalism regional disparities etc which are very crucial factors in achieving a real developmentThe book is useful for the researchers of various disciplines planners academicians and for all those who have interest in the subject and are involved in the architecture of planning jacket 248 pp.

Contents Preface List of contributors I 1 Disparities in growth and structure of state economiesKuldip Kaur 2 Extent of inter-state disparities in Sectoral development multiple variable approachPC Sarker 3 Inter-state variation in level of road development in India--a method of regional analysisB Kanaga Durai and Deep Chandra 4 Economic reforms on development of infrastructure in the Indian statesRV Dadibhavi 5 The standard of living in India an attempt towards inter-regional studyManaranjan Behra and Ajit Kumar Mitra 6 Inter-state migration in IndiaPranati Datta II 7 Regional variation in agricultural development in Andhra PradeshK Pochanna 8 Disparities of agricultural development in Rajasthan an analysis of governing factorsAnju Kohli and Sadhna Kothari 9 Regional disparities and development of Andhra Pradesh a comparative study of Telangana RegionP Padmanabha Rao 10 New economic policy and disparities of agricultural development in Madhya PradeshAmitabh Shukla and Narendra Shukla 11 Ecosystem and sustainable mountain development case of Jammu and KashmirRB Singh 12 The regional intra-industry disparity a crisis processManas Dasgupta and Ajit Kumar Pal 13 Levels of human resource development and economic growth in a segment of middle Ganga plainSinha BRK 14 Linkages of population and work-force structure with sustainable development -- a case study of North-East IndiaAK Agarwal III 15 Determination of agricultural development an inter-district analysisSmiriti Banerjee 16 District level development indices a factor analytical approachSC Gulati 17 A note on estimating per capita income at district levelM Mallikarjun IndexThe objective of every planning system planning mechanism or planning process is to provide a better life to its population It consists of shelter food employment better infrastructure and health facilities better education and other basic amenities These are essential conditions for the welfare of individuals as well as for a over all development of the nation The prime objective behind the above is t reduce the disparities in every walk of lifeThe planning process in India has witnessed the existence of disparities at various levels even the inter personal disparities has widened which is the outcome of increasing inter-regional and inter-sectoral disparitiesIn this context the present book is as an effective attempt towards measuring the disparities pertaining to infrastructure agricultural industrial banking sectors and at the income level etc as well at various levels ie at inter-regional and intra-regional levelsAs the findings are based upon very intensive research analysis and analyses the factors responsible for disparities and also suggest the models and polices it has wider usefulness for the researchers and policy makers Even the findings are quite relevant for all those have interest n the developmental process and are involved in making plans and policies for attaining a sustainable developmentLooking into the analysis of various dimensions of developmental process the coverage of this book is quite relevant and useful for many Asian and African national who are in the initial stage of development 286 pp.
